I REFER to the letter, "Reach out and integrate foreigners into Singaporean society" (my paper, Oct 8).

Though we have our cultural differences, on a basic level, Singaporeans and foreigners are human beings who have the same sense of right and wrong.

We talk about being a gracious society; here is an opportunity for us to practise our social graces.

It would be good for Residents' Committees to organise activities to welcome foreign workers to the neighbourhood.

If they feel a sense of acceptance and belonging, they will be less likely to misbehave and will try to conduct themselves properly.
